Mehrower Allee is a railway station in the Marzahn-Hellersdorf district of Berlin. It is served by the S-Bahn line S7.

One Hundred Views of New Tokyo was a series of woodblock prints created from 1928 to 1932 by eight artists of the sōsaku hanga \"creative print\" movement.

Zoroark, known in Japan as Zoroaku , is a Pokémon species in Nintendo and Game Freak's Pokémon media franchise. First introduced in the film Pokémon—Zoroark: Master of Illusions and later in the video games Pokémon Black and White, it was created by Atsuko Nishida with the design finalized by Sugimori. Zoroark has since appeared in multiple games including Pokémon Go and the Pokémon Trading Card Game, as well as various merchandise.
